The International Baccalaureate, also called IB, is one of the most popular programs around the world thanks to its international recognition and transferability. Most students love learning in the IB system because it doesn’t just teach students content or knowledge, but it also teaches them how to learn and how to think. Many students describe the IB curriculum as challenging, but rewarding. The PYP is very accessible, as is the MYP. To do the DP students should be prepared to work hard as the IB Diploma prepares students for university.
Why choose an IB school in Quebec?
Choosing an International Baccalaureate (IB) school in Quebec offers a plethora of benefits tailored to cultivate the intellectual, personal, emotional, and social skills needed to live, learn, and work in a rapidly globalizing world. The IB curriculum emphasizes a holistic approach to education, encouraging students not only to excel academically but also to develop as well-rounded individuals.
Global Recognition and Academic Rigour
The IB Diploma is highly recognized by universities worldwide, often giving students an edge in the competitive admissions process. IB schools in Quebec maintain a rigorous standard of education that challenges students to think critically, synthesize knowledge, and reflect on their learning experiences. This rigorous academic culture helps students develop strong analytical and problem-solving skills, which are highly valued in higher education and beyond.
Comprehensive Curriculum
The IB curriculum is unique in that it covers a wide range of subjects and encourages interdisciplinary learning. Students engage in studies across the sciences, mathematics, humanities, and arts, ensuring a well-rounded educational experience. This broad approach helps students to connect learning across disciplines, fostering a better understanding of how the world is interconnected.
Development of Strong Personal Values
IB schools focus on the personal development of students as much as their academic success. The IB learner profile aims to develop learners who are inquirers, knowledgeable, thinkers, communicators, principled, open-minded, caring, risk-takers, balanced, and reflective. These attributes help to prepare students not just for academic environments but also for personal and professional challenges throughout their lives.
Language Proficiency and Cultural Awareness
In Quebec, where bilingualism is a part of the fabric of society, IB schools place a strong emphasis on language development. Most IB schools offer programs in both of France’s official languages, and sometimes in additional languages, which greatly enhances students' linguistic abilities and cultural awareness. The ability to communicate in multiple languages is an invaluable skill in the global job market and fosters greater cultural sensitivity.
Community Connection and Real-World Application
The IB curriculum includes components that require students to engage directly with their communities, such as the Creativity, Activity, Service (CAS) project. This not only helps students apply their knowledge in real-world settings but also instills a strong sense of community and social responsibility. Furthermore, the Extended Essay—an independent, self-directed piece of research—finishes the program with a capstone project that hones research skills and deepens knowledge in a chosen area of interest.
In summary, an IB education in Quebec equips students with a formidable blend of academic rigor, a comprehensive and interconnected curriculum, and the development of crucial personal and interpersonal skills. For parents seeking an education that prepares children not just for university but for a successful, balanced, and impactful life, an IB school in Quebec is an excellent choice.

How much do IB Schools in Quebec cost?
According to World Schools data, the yearly tuition fee for IB Schools in Quebec ranges between $9800 and $13000. However, the cost varies significantly depending on various factors such as the school curriculum, extracurricular activities, location, and facilities, and can go up to $31200.
The average yearly cost is $11900, around $1200 per month, and can go up to the maximum monthly cost of $3200.
Additionally, most schools will also charge a one-time registration fee, and you also need to count an extra budget during the year for extracurricular trips, holiday camps, etc.
